Does anyone know if the single rider queue is seperate from the main queue and opens when the ride opens?
The single rider queue is a separate queue from the main queue, and it is the same queue those with a disabled pass or fastpass use, before it splits into 3 different queues.

I'm not sure if it opens right from when the ride opens, but you're unable to queue for it like you do for the main queue, during ERT (as far as I'm aware). However, there have been reports that the SRQ gets closed if it becomes too long.

I was at the park yesterday with a group of friends.

We bought 6x fast track for The Smiler from the entrance ticket kiosk at £6 each for 2pm-3pm. They were definitely worth it as we pretty much walked straight onto the ride. The queue at the time was saying 90 mins. I bought them at about 9.45 and they still had later times available.

If I get time later I might post a review, but for now I'll say it's an awesome ride and a fantastic addition to the park, however it doesn't beat Nemesis for me. I was in the far left seat of the front row and didn't think it was too rough or notice the jolts people have been mentioning. It was over a lot quicker than I thought it would be, the first half in particular. I got a good spraying but hardly noticed the other effects. I must say, the station staff were very efficient and we're turning the trains around super quick.

Overall we had a great day and managed 1 ride on everything we wanted to do, (apart from Oblivion of course, but I wasn't expecting it to be open). The longest we queued all day was about 45 minutes for Rita which included a 15-20 minute breakdown.
